#451b68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#451b68 is composed of 27.1% red, 10.6%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.7% cyan, 74%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 272.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.8% and a lightness of 25.7%. #451b68 color hex could be obtained by blending #8a36d0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#451b68 color description : Very dark violet.
#451b68 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#451b68 has RGB values of R:69, G:27,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 4529000.

Shades and Tints of #451b68
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07030b is the darkest color, while #fcf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#451b68
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#423e45 is the less saturated color, while #470281 is the most saturated one.
